Abstract

In the game industry, there are many innovations that can be implemented in a game, one of which is implementing artificial intelligence on Non-Playable Character (NPC) characters so that the game is more lively and not boring when played. Game genre Role Playing Games (RPG) is one game that can implement artificial intelligence, where the player fully controls the action of the characters in a fictional world in video games. The artificial intelligence developed in this game is to implement the Finite State Machine which will be used to design and regulate the behavioral response of the enemy's Non-Player Character (NPC) to ambush, attack, chase and fight with players so that the response of the enemy NPCs can be determined based on the interactions that occur. done by the player. The test results of this study indicate that the Finite State Machine can provide artificial intelligence to the behavior and character traits of enemy NPCs based on interactions made by players so that the game feels more alive and not boring.
